Thiruvananthapuram: The Indian Armed forces showcased a unique way to thank all the coronavirus frontline warriors today starting with the laying of wreaths by the three service chiefs at the police memorial in Delhi this morning to honour police personnel deployed for enforcement of the nationwide lockdown, flypast by the Air Force to lighting up of warships by the Navy.
Indian Army meanwhile honoured the police officers in Thiruvananthapuram Police Headquarters when Pangode Military station commander Brigadier Karthik Sheshadri presented a cake to state police chief Lokanath Behra.
Gloves, masks and greeting cards were also handed over to the police.
Brigadier Karthik Sheshadri said that the work exercised by the police alsong with healthcare workers, cleaning workers and other government agencies is invaluable. He also lauded the effort of the police in implementing the lockdown and containing the disease.
DGP appreciated the Army’s thanksgiving gesture to the police forces across the country.
